  3. Not quite... I'll explain it. (I'm dying too, can't you tell!! LOL!) All US registered aircraft (other than military) will start with an "N" for their "tail number." So in fact I made up a tail number that reflects something I believe in... "N" (IN) "2" (2) "6" (G) "0" (O) "D" () INTO GOD. Guess it's just not "all that" is it?? Hahahaaa So here's where I got the idea... Greg Norman (the golfer) flew his Cessna Citation X into an airport I was working at some years back, and his tail number was "N260LF" or INTO GOLF. It's a play on having to use numbers to look like letters due to the constraints of how the registration rules are setup for the US.
